Subject: Encoding detection hardening in Textgate 2.4

Team, the new release replaces heuristic charset sniffing with a strict BOM-first detector, falling back to UTF-8 validation before any transcoding. Malformed sequences now reject the upload rather than silently substituting replacement characters, closing the smuggling vector flagged in last quarter's review. The trace token for the reviewed build appears below.

trace token, fafog-kageg: htk4_98e6

CI Note — Kioskette Watchdog

Watchdog restarts during CI are expected when the Kioskette app stalls past 30s. Flag only restarts triggered by signature-verification failures; those abort the pipeline. Logs rotate hourly, so pull them fast. Verification ran against the artifact identified by the token below.

build token for tahop-fafof: htk14_2d55df8101eccc

= Encoding Detection: Limits and Quotas =

The Tarnwick upload service runs charset detection on every text file before indexing. Detection reads only a bounded prefix of the file; anything beyond that is assumed to match the detected encoding. Files that exceed the sample confidence floor fall back to UTF-8 with replacement characters, and a warning is attached to the upload record. These limits are release-gated, so any change requires sign-off before the Quillford train ships. The current tuning constants are listed below for reference.

tuning constants:
QUOTAS = {
    "druwyn": 5,
    "holix": 5,
    "zorath": 5,
    "holwyn": 10,
}

The request covers hardware replacement, contractor time, and a contingency of roughly ten percent. Without this funding, the Quillon reporting platform will remain on unsupported infrastructure through next spring, raising both cost and continuity risk. Please review the attached breakdown before Thursday's allocation meeting and submit objections in writing. A confidential note for this group appears below.

board note of fawep-tajof: Kasdorek Systems plans to raise the Gilox list price by 53.8 percent in July. The finance team signed off on a budget of $92.9 million for Project Istox. The renewal with Praaelax Holdings closes at $122.1 million a year, 58.0 percent below the last contract. Project Drudor slips by one quarter because of the audit delay.